Grasping the Online Rental Marketplace Model}
An online rental marketplace bridges property owners (hosts) with possible tenants through a digital platform. The secret to a effective marketplace lies in aligning the needs of both sides: hosts want reach and simple property management, while guests demand a smooth booking experience.
The marketplace typically generates revenue through transaction fees, membership plans, or premium listings. However, simply launching a platform isn’t enough. Conversion requires delivering trust, usability, and security at every step of the user journey.
Key Features That Boost High Conversion}
To create a marketplace like Airbnb that encourages users to finalize bookings, your platform must focus on features that enhance user experience, participation, and trust.
1. Intuitive Property Lookup and Filtering
Guests should be able to look up properties based on destination, cost, features, accommodation style, and dates. Sophisticated filtering options boost the chances of users getting the perfect match, lowering drop-offs and increasing bookings.
2. User-Friendly Reservation Flow
A hassle-free booking process with clear pricing, calendar syncing, and flexible terms increases conversion. Including instant booking and calendar syncing with hosts’ schedules removes friction and delivers accuracy.
3. Secure Transaction System
Include multiple secure payment options, including copyright/Mastercard, e-wallets, and cross-border gateways. Security features like secure sockets, risk monitoring, and fund holding reassure users and secure both hosts and guests.
Trusted Profiles and Feedback
Credibility is essential in peer-to-peer marketplaces. Introduce identity verification for both hosts and guests, and add a strong review system. Verified profiles, scores, and reviews reassure users of the platform’s integrity.

How to Construct an Online Rental Platform
Creating a profitable online rental marketplace demands strategic planning and execution. Here’s a step-by-step approach:
Research and Focused Niche Choice
Evaluate target audiences, competitor offerings, and new trends. Picking a niche, such as luxury rentals, pet-friendly stays, or eco-friendly properties, differentiates your platform.
Platform Architecture and Technology Stack
Determine between a browser-based solution or a app-first solution. Technologies like React, Django, or Ruby on Rails can power your web application, while Swift and Android SDK enable mobile development.
